Established in 1999, BM Institute of Engineering & Technology (BMIET) is a premier institution affiliated with Guru Gobind Singh Indraprastha University (GGSIPU), New Delhi, and approved by AICTE, Ministry of Education, Government of India. Located in Sonepat, Haryana, BMIET is committed to providing quality technical education and shaping future-ready professionals. Our campus fosters academic excellence, innovation, and holistic development. We offer undergraduate programs in Computer Science, Information Technology, Electronics & Communication, Electrical & Electronics, Mechanical Engineering, and Business Administration (BBA).
